iconoscopes

[US]/ˈaɪ.kə.nə.skoʊp/
[UK]/ˈaɪ.kə.nə.skoʊp/
Frequency: Very High

Translation

n.a type of photoelectric imaging tube used in television cameras; an imaging tube
